At a given signal the tubes were all raised simultaneously depositing a large volume of concrete into the bottom of the caisson sufficient to withstand the water pressure from outside.
It would appear that the working area available would be ample for the contractor's requirements. This was not the case as part of the ground was used for coal storage and excavation for foundations, pump-pits and culverts had to proceed simultaneously with piling. To add to the congestion, structural steel arrived before the foundations were ready. The unloading of the steel members presented an unusual problem. They were dis- charged from steamers into junks which were towed alongside the seawall close by the proposed New Station. The junk jib could lift a maximum load of 5 tons but
several girders weighed 7 tons. As the factor of safety of a junk's jib is generally about 1 in 1, 7 tons was a load the master was not prepared to tackle. The next rise in the tide, however, solved the difficulty as it was high enough to enable the girders to be moved on rollers off the junk on to the seawall!
Parts of the new boiler began to arrive shortly after the structural steel, and the erection of the steel for the Boiler House had to be rushed accordingly. At one stage 100 tons of steelwork was completely assembled in one week. So that work could be continued without inter- ruption during the rainy season, the whole building site was covered with matting carried on bamboo framework. This was completed in less than a fortnight.
